During the closing stages of the war, President Harry Truman foresaw a future conflict with communist Russia. As both nations’ armies invaded and took control of Berlin it was apparent that whichever country controlled the military and scientific secrets developed by the Germans would have an upper hand in the upcoming cold war. Within a short period of time the American authorities searched and discovered the whereabouts of the third Reich scientists.

Some of these professionals were readily accepted into American society while others produced a public outcry at the mere thought of bringing them to American soil. Our initial focus for bringing them here was in the area of rocket technology and their knowledge could prove invaluable. The authorities immediately set out to locate and bring these gifted technicians to our country. The complete project was given the code name Operation Overcast.

The CIA began plans to gather these scientists up and deliver them to our homeland. The initial scientist recruited was the German father of rocketry Wernher von Braun. Von Braun would eventually become a central figure for America's race for space. In 1946, Operation Overcast was changed to Operation Paper-clip which was effectively a program to recruit any foreign scientists or technicians which could be of use to the America military establishment. Men such as Walter Schreiber, who performed numerous experiments upon the holocaust victims were not welcomed by the public to our country. On the surface, it appeared that Operation Paper-clip was a great success for our side with its advances in code-breaking and general scientific excellence.

Unfortunately, we have now discovered that Operation Paper-clip had a dark side as well. Many of the relocated Germans were murdered and torturers during the war. Programs conducted by these men and women included the "MK Ultra mind control program" which had as its goals the ability to influence the thought processes of its victims. Keep in mind these people conducting these experiments were convicted war criminals now doing similar experiments in America that they previously had accomplished at Dachau.

Kurt Blome was placed on trial at Nuremberg and would have been sentenced to death for his war crimes had not America step in to save him. Their goal was to employ Blome for our military biological and chemical warfare program. His knowledge and past experimentation with plague vaccines on the death camp inmates earned him a position on American Top-Secret projects. Eventually justice took effect and Blome was tried and convicted for his war crimes in France.

The "MK Ultra" was not the only dark experiments devised by the brutal ex-third Reich scientists. As the "MK Ultra", rolled on there was another offshoot known as "Operation Midnight Climax" which saw paper-clip scientists experimenting on people who had been lured to various CIA safe houses by prostitutes and then drugged in order to analyze the effects of LSD on the mind.

Many of the scientists brought to our country were die hard third Reich followers who could never change their political views. In all we ended up bringing over 1,600 German scientists, spies, and engineers across the Atlantic specifically to work on paper-clip projects.
